Observability brings transparency to application landscapes and, among other things, shifts responsibility for application monitoring towards application developers. Ideally, all members of the development team work together with operations towards the common goal of observability. As applications and infrastructure are constantly evolving, the goal of observability is also a moving target. This is why, like DevOps, observability should be understood as a sporting and philosophical mindset that influences all areas of software development and infrastructure.
